Tips for Playing Poker Like a Pro in a Casino Setting

Playing poker in a casino environment requires a blend of skill, strategy, and psychological insight. Unlike casual home games, casino poker demands a higher level of discipline and awareness due to the competitive atmosphere and the presence of professional players. Understanding the nuances of casino etiquette, managing your bankroll effectively, and staying focused on the game are essential for anyone aiming to improve their poker performance in such a setting.

One fundamental aspect to master is reading your opponents and adapting your strategy accordingly. Observing betting patterns, body language, and timing can provide valuable clues about the strength of their hands. It’s also crucial to maintain a balanced approach in your play style to avoid becoming predictable. Practicing patience and knowing when to fold or raise can significantly influence your long-term success at the casino poker table.
